Diamonds are typically clear, make excellent abrasives, and are good electrical … WebFeb 18, 2014 · Diamond (left) and graphite (right) are both made of carbon atoms, but arranged in different ways. Image source In graphite, all the carbon atoms have strong chemical bonds to three other carbon atoms, making sheets that look like chicken wire; weak forces hold the sheets together in stacks that can slide past each other easily.

The way the carbon atoms are arranged in space, however, is different for the three materials, making them allotropes of carbon. grand park la concertWebFeb 26, 2024 · Diamond turns into graphite spontaneously, but that does not mean it occurs fast. In fact, it happens very very slowly, for kinetics rather than thermodynamics is controlling this reaction. The diamond is kinetically stable with respect to graphite, yet thermodynamically unstable.
